It's head-to-head first yes.

For Sevilla to qualify for the ECL requires:

  1. Real Sociedad vs Sevilla - away win
  2. Osasuna vs Girona - draw
  3. Real Madrid vs Bilbao - home win or draw
  4. Real Mallorca vs Rayo Vallecano - home win or draw
  5. Sevilla vs Roma - Roma champions

I'm getting 41/1 on this so 2.5% chance.
